From Fringe to Powerful: Bezalel Smotrich's Controversial Ascent in Israeli Politics

In the complex political landscape of Israel, Bezalel Smotrich has emerged as a pivotal figure, rapidly ascending to become one of the most powerful politicians alongside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u. As the country's finance minister, Smotrich has captured national attention with his controversial yet influential political stance.
A key member of the far-right Religious Zionism party, Smotrich has transformed from a marginal political figure to a central player in Israel's government. His rise reflects the shifting dynamics of Israeli politics, where ideological hardliners have gained significant ground in recent years.
